Charlie Cox Confirms Daredevil Return in Future MCU Project: "There Will Be Something Else"


One of the highlights of Spider-Man: No Way Home is the cameo appearance of Charlie Cox's Matt Murdock. A lot of fans were delighted by his return as it means that Cox as the Man Without Fear is officially part of the MCU canon. Of course, the question now is when will the character make his next appearance on the MCU? There have been rumors and speculations that he will be appearing in shows like She-Hulk or his own solo show, but none of them have been confirmed so far. While we don't have the answers yet, Cox himself has assured us that we will be seeing him again soon.

In an interview with RadioTimes.com, Cox confirmed that he will be playing Matt Murdock/Daredevil again in a future MCU project although he didn't reveal which specific title it would be or the nature of his comeback. "I know something," he said. "I don't know much, but I know there will be something else."

He also shared how he got the call that he will be reprising the role again in No Way Home and his fear that his return might not actually materialize at all. "I got a phone call saying, 'Do you want to come back? Do you want to be in Spider-Man?' and I was like, 'Obviously, yeah! That would be amazing. I'm thrilled. I'd love to do that.'," he revealed. "They said 'Great, we'll be in touch.' and then I didn't hear anything for, like, two months! I did get to the point where I was like, 'Did I dream this?' – I definitely got to the point where I was, like, 'I don't know what's gonna happen.' But then I got a follow-up phone call."

It is great that we have a confirmation now from Cox himself that we will be seeing again in another MCU project soon. Right now, it is rumored that his next appearance will be in She-Hulk which would make sense since it is a legal show and Matt Murdock is, of course, a lawyer. There have also been rumors that Cox will be starring in another season of Daredevil which fans have been clamoring for ever since the cancellation of the Netflix series.

With Cox's No Way Home cameo and the appearance of Vincent D'Onofrio's Kingpin in Hawkeye, it looks like the MCU is slowly starting to integrate some of the characters from the Netflix shows although it is still unknown if they are now officially considered as part of the MCU canon. Nevertheless, it is exciting to see them return again and it would be curious to see what direction they are going to take in the MCU.
